Neal Beckstedt, a renowned interior designer, has breathed new life into his 1890s Sag Harbor home, restoring it with a fresh aesthetic that seamlessly blends the old and the new. The home's design harmonizes the historical charm with a contemporary twist, which is a testament to Beckstedt's deft touch.
When Beckstedt first laid eyes on this historical Sag Harbor home, he was captivated by its old-world charm. Despite the house being in a state of disrepair, its potential was undeniable. The designer embarked on a labor of love to restore this 130-year-old property to its former glory, while also infusing it with his own modern design sensibilities.
The Journey of Restoration
Beckstedt's renovation journey was fraught with challenges, but his determination never wavered. His goal was clear – to preserve the home's historical integrity while introducing contemporary elements. He meticulously restored the original woodwork, the large windows, and the fireplace, which are all key elements of the home's character.

The Kitchen Transformation
The kitchen underwent a remarkable transformation. Originally a small, cramped space, it was expanded and reimagined into a functional, open area. Beckstedt integrated modern amenities with traditional design cues, achieving a balance between utility and aesthetics.
